Historically, hemp was often demonized alongside cannabis until it became clear that this non-intoxicating variant held medicinal benefits. The Federal Legalization under the 2018 Farm Bill marked a paradigm shift; suddenly, compounds derived from hemp containing less than 0.3% Delta-9 THC were no longer prohibited but celebrated as federally compliant goods. Here lies the core of the paradox surrounding gummies such as Area 52's: despite being legal across all states, some local regulations still impose restrictions on their sale, underscoring an ambiguous social landscape where acceptance doesn't equate to accessibility.
